68 // This should get the default rounding mode from the kernel. We just set the
69 // default here, but this could change if the OpenCL rounding mode pragmas are
70 // used.
71 //
72 // The denormal mode here should match what is reported by the OpenCL runtime
73 // for the CL_FP_DENORM bit from CL_DEVICE_{HALF|SINGLE|DOUBLE}_FP_CONFIG, but
74 // can also be override to flush with the -cl-denorms-are-zero compiler flag.
75 //
76 // AMD OpenCL only sets flush none and reports CL_FP_DENORM for double
77 // precision, and leaves single precision to flush all and does not report
78 // CL_FP_DENORM for CL_DEVICE_SINGLE_FP_CONFIG. Mesa's OpenCL currently reports
79 // CL_FP_DENORM for both.
80 //
81 // FIXME: It seems some instructions do not support single precision denormals
82 // regardless of the mode (exp_*_f32, rcp_*_f32, rsq_*_f32, rsq_*f32, sqrt_f32,
83 // and sin_f32, cos_f32 on most parts).
84
85 // We want to use these instructions, and using fp32 denormals also causes
86 // instructions to run at the double precision rate for the device so it's
87 // probably best to just report no single precision denormals.
getFPMode(AMDGPU::SIModeRegisterDefaults Mode)88 static uint32_t getFPMode(AMDGPU::SIModeRegisterDefaults Mode) {
89 return FP_ROUND_MODE_SP(FP_ROUND_ROUND_TO_NEAREST) |
90 FP_ROUND_MODE_DP(FP_ROUND_ROUND_TO_NEAREST) |
91 FP_DENORM_MODE_SP(Mode.fpDenormModeSPValue()) |
92 FP_DENORM_MODE_DP(Mode.fpDenormModeDPValue());
93 }

analyzeResourceUsage(const MachineFunction & MF) const631 AMDGPUAsmPrinter::SIFunctionResourceInfo AMDGPUAsmPrinter::analyzeResourceUsage(
632 const MachineFunction &MF) const {
633 SIFunctionResourceInfo Info;
634
635 const SIMachineFunctionInfo *MFI = MF.getInfo<SIMachineFunctionInfo>();
636 const GCNSubtarget &ST = MF.getSubtarget<GCNSubtarget>();
637 const MachineFrameInfo &FrameInfo = MF.getFrameInfo();
638 const MachineRegisterInfo &MRI = MF.getRegInfo();
639 const SIInstrInfo *TII = ST.getInstrInfo();
640 const SIRegisterInfo &TRI = TII->getRegisterInfo();
641
642 Info.UsesFlatScratch = MRI.isPhysRegUsed(AMDGPU::FLAT_SCR_LO) ||
643 MRI.isPhysRegUsed(AMDGPU::FLAT_SCR_HI);
644
645 // Even if FLAT_SCRATCH is implicitly used, it has no effect if flat
646 // instructions aren't used to access the scratch buffer. Inline assembly may
647 // need it though.
648 //
649 // If we only have implicit uses of flat_scr on flat instructions, it is not
650 // really needed.
651 if (Info.UsesFlatScratch && !MFI->hasFlatScratchInit() &&
652 (!hasAnyNonFlatUseOfReg(MRI, *TII, AMDGPU::FLAT_SCR) &&
653 !hasAnyNonFlatUseOfReg(MRI, *TII, AMDGPU::FLAT_SCR_LO) &&
654 !hasAnyNonFlatUseOfReg(MRI, *TII, AMDGPU::FLAT_SCR_HI))) {
655 Info.UsesFlatScratch = false;
656 }
657
658 Info.PrivateSegmentSize = FrameInfo.getStackSize();
659
660 // Assume a big number if there are any unknown sized objects.
661 Info.HasDynamicallySizedStack = FrameInfo.hasVarSizedObjects();
662 if (Info.HasDynamicallySizedStack)
663 Info.PrivateSegmentSize += AssumedStackSizeForDynamicSizeObjects;
664
665 if (MFI->isStackRealigned())
666 Info.PrivateSegmentSize += FrameInfo.getMaxAlign().value();
667
668 Info.UsesVCC = MRI.isPhysRegUsed(AMDGPU::VCC_LO) ||
669 MRI.isPhysRegUsed(AMDGPU::VCC_HI);
670
671 // If there are no calls, MachineRegisterInfo can tell us the used register
672 // count easily.
673 // A tail call isn't considered a call for MachineFrameInfo's purposes.
674 if (!FrameInfo.hasCalls() && !FrameInfo.hasTailCall()) {
675 MCPhysReg HighestVGPRReg = AMDGPU::NoRegister;
676 for (MCPhysReg Reg : reverse(AMDGPU::VGPR_32RegClass.getRegisters())) {
677 if (MRI.isPhysRegUsed(Reg)) {
678 HighestVGPRReg = Reg;
679 break;
680 }
681 }
682
683 if (ST.hasMAIInsts()) {
684 MCPhysReg HighestAGPRReg = AMDGPU::NoRegister;
685 for (MCPhysReg Reg : reverse(AMDGPU::AGPR_32RegClass.getRegisters())) {
686 if (MRI.isPhysRegUsed(Reg)) {
687 HighestAGPRReg = Reg;
688 break;
689 }
690 }
691 Info.NumAGPR = HighestAGPRReg == AMDGPU::NoRegister ? 0 :
692 TRI.getHWRegIndex(HighestAGPRReg) + 1;
693 }
694
695 MCPhysReg HighestSGPRReg = AMDGPU::NoRegister;
696 for (MCPhysReg Reg : reverse(AMDGPU::SGPR_32RegClass.getRegisters())) {
697 if (MRI.isPhysRegUsed(Reg)) {
698 HighestSGPRReg = Reg;
699 break;
700 }
701 }
702
703 // We found the maximum register index. They start at 0, so add one to get the
704 // number of registers.
705 Info.NumVGPR = HighestVGPRReg == AMDGPU::NoRegister ? 0 :
706 TRI.getHWRegIndex(HighestVGPRReg) + 1;
707 Info.NumExplicitSGPR = HighestSGPRReg == AMDGPU::NoRegister ? 0 :
708 TRI.getHWRegIndex(HighestSGPRReg) + 1;
709
710 return Info;
711 }
712

getSIProgramInfo(SIProgramInfo & ProgInfo,const MachineFunction & MF)982 void AMDGPUAsmPrinter::getSIProgramInfo(SIProgramInfo &ProgInfo,
983 const MachineFunction &MF) {
984 SIFunctionResourceInfo Info = analyzeResourceUsage(MF);
985 const GCNSubtarget &STM = MF.getSubtarget<GCNSubtarget>();
986
987 ProgInfo.NumArchVGPR = Info.NumVGPR;
988 ProgInfo.NumAccVGPR = Info.NumAGPR;
989 ProgInfo.NumVGPR = Info.getTotalNumVGPRs(STM);
990 ProgInfo.NumSGPR = Info.NumExplicitSGPR;
991 ProgInfo.ScratchSize = Info.PrivateSegmentSize;
992 ProgInfo.VCCUsed = Info.UsesVCC;
993 ProgInfo.FlatUsed = Info.UsesFlatScratch;
994 ProgInfo.DynamicCallStack = Info.HasDynamicallySizedStack || Info.HasRecursion;
995
996 const uint64_t MaxScratchPerWorkitem =
997 GCNSubtarget::MaxWaveScratchSize / STM.getWavefrontSize();
998 if (ProgInfo.ScratchSize > MaxScratchPerWorkitem) {
999 DiagnosticInfoStackSize DiagStackSize(MF.getFunction(),
1000 ProgInfo.ScratchSize, DS_Error);
1001 MF.getFunction().getContext().diagnose(DiagStackSize);
1002 }
1003
1004 const SIMachineFunctionInfo *MFI = MF.getInfo<SIMachineFunctionInfo>();
1005
1006 // TODO(scott.linder): The calculations related to SGPR/VGPR blocks are
1007 // duplicated in part in AMDGPUAsmParser::calculateGPRBlocks, and could be
1008 // unified.
1009 unsigned ExtraSGPRs = IsaInfo::getNumExtraSGPRs(
1010 &STM, ProgInfo.VCCUsed, ProgInfo.FlatUsed);
1011
1012 // Check the addressable register limit before we add ExtraSGPRs.
1013 if (STM.getGeneration() >= AMDGPUSubtarget::VOLCANIC_ISLANDS &&
1014 !STM.hasSGPRInitBug()) {
1015 unsigned MaxAddressableNumSGPRs = STM.getAddressableNumSGPRs();
1016 if (ProgInfo.NumSGPR > MaxAddressableNumSGPRs) {
1017 // This can happen due to a compiler bug or when using inline asm.
1018 LLVMContext &Ctx = MF.getFunction().getContext();
1019 DiagnosticInfoResourceLimit Diag(MF.getFunction(),
1020 "addressable scalar registers",
1021 ProgInfo.NumSGPR, DS_Error,
1022 DK_ResourceLimit,
1023 MaxAddressableNumSGPRs);
1024 Ctx.diagnose(Diag);
1025 ProgInfo.NumSGPR = MaxAddressableNumSGPRs - 1;
1026 }
1027 }
1028
1029 // Account for extra SGPRs and VGPRs reserved for debugger use.
1030 ProgInfo.NumSGPR += ExtraSGPRs;
1031
1032 // Ensure there are enough SGPRs and VGPRs for wave dispatch, where wave
1033 // dispatch registers are function args.
1034 unsigned WaveDispatchNumSGPR = 0, WaveDispatchNumVGPR = 0;
1035 for (auto &Arg : MF.getFunction().args()) {
1036 unsigned NumRegs = (Arg.getType()->getPrimitiveSizeInBits() + 31) / 32;
1037 if (Arg.hasAttribute(Attribute::InReg))
1038 WaveDispatchNumSGPR += NumRegs;
1039 else
1040 WaveDispatchNumVGPR += NumRegs;
1041 }
1042 ProgInfo.NumSGPR = std::max(ProgInfo.NumSGPR, WaveDispatchNumSGPR);
1043 ProgInfo.NumVGPR = std::max(ProgInfo.NumVGPR, WaveDispatchNumVGPR);
1044
1045 // Adjust number of registers used to meet default/requested minimum/maximum
1046 // number of waves per execution unit request.
1047 ProgInfo.NumSGPRsForWavesPerEU = std::max(
1048 std::max(ProgInfo.NumSGPR, 1u), STM.getMinNumSGPRs(MFI->getMaxWavesPerEU()));
1049 ProgInfo.NumVGPRsForWavesPerEU = std::max(
1050 std::max(ProgInfo.NumVGPR, 1u), STM.getMinNumVGPRs(MFI->getMaxWavesPerEU()));
1051
1052 if (STM.getGeneration() <= AMDGPUSubtarget::SEA_ISLANDS ||
1053 STM.hasSGPRInitBug()) {
1054 unsigned MaxAddressableNumSGPRs = STM.getAddressableNumSGPRs();
1055 if (ProgInfo.NumSGPR > MaxAddressableNumSGPRs) {
1056 // This can happen due to a compiler bug or when using inline asm to use
1057 // the registers which are usually reserved for vcc etc.
1058 LLVMContext &Ctx = MF.getFunction().getContext();
1059 DiagnosticInfoResourceLimit Diag(MF.getFunction(),
1060 "scalar registers",
1061 ProgInfo.NumSGPR, DS_Error,
1062 DK_ResourceLimit,
1063 MaxAddressableNumSGPRs);
1064 Ctx.diagnose(Diag);
1065 ProgInfo.NumSGPR = MaxAddressableNumSGPRs;
1066 ProgInfo.NumSGPRsForWavesPerEU = MaxAddressableNumSGPRs;
1067 }
1068 }
1069
1070 if (STM.hasSGPRInitBug()) {
1071 ProgInfo.NumSGPR =
1072 AMDGPU::IsaInfo::FIXED_NUM_SGPRS_FOR_INIT_BUG;
1073 ProgInfo.NumSGPRsForWavesPerEU =
1074 AMDGPU::IsaInfo::FIXED_NUM_SGPRS_FOR_INIT_BUG;
1075 }
1076
1077 if (MFI->getNumUserSGPRs() > STM.getMaxNumUserSGPRs()) {
1078 LLVMContext &Ctx = MF.getFunction().getContext();
1079 DiagnosticInfoResourceLimit Diag(MF.getFunction(), "user SGPRs",
1080 MFI->getNumUserSGPRs(), DS_Error);
1081 Ctx.diagnose(Diag);
1082 }
1083
1084 if (MFI->getLDSSize() > static_cast<unsigned>(STM.getLocalMemorySize())) {
1085 LLVMContext &Ctx = MF.getFunction().getContext();
1086 DiagnosticInfoResourceLimit Diag(MF.getFunction(), "local memory",
1087 MFI->getLDSSize(), DS_Error);
1088 Ctx.diagnose(Diag);
1089 }
1090
1091 ProgInfo.SGPRBlocks = IsaInfo::getNumSGPRBlocks(
1092 &STM, ProgInfo.NumSGPRsForWavesPerEU);
1093 ProgInfo.VGPRBlocks = IsaInfo::getNumVGPRBlocks(
1094 &STM, ProgInfo.NumVGPRsForWavesPerEU);
1095
1096 const SIModeRegisterDefaults Mode = MFI->getMode();
1097
1098 // Set the value to initialize FP_ROUND and FP_DENORM parts of the mode
1099 // register.
1100 ProgInfo.FloatMode = getFPMode(Mode);
1101
1102 ProgInfo.IEEEMode = Mode.IEEE;
1103
1104 // Make clamp modifier on NaN input returns 0.
1105 ProgInfo.DX10Clamp = Mode.DX10Clamp;
1106
1107 unsigned LDSAlignShift;
1108 if (STM.getGeneration() < AMDGPUSubtarget::SEA_ISLANDS) {
1109 // LDS is allocated in 64 dword blocks.
1110 LDSAlignShift = 8;
1111 } else {
1112 // LDS is allocated in 128 dword blocks.
1113 LDSAlignShift = 9;
1114 }
1115
1116 unsigned LDSSpillSize =
1117 MFI->getLDSWaveSpillSize() * MFI->getMaxFlatWorkGroupSize();
1118
1119 ProgInfo.LDSSize = MFI->getLDSSize() + LDSSpillSize;
1120 ProgInfo.LDSBlocks =
1121 alignTo(ProgInfo.LDSSize, 1ULL << LDSAlignShift) >> LDSAlignShift;
1122
1123 // Scratch is allocated in 256 dword blocks.
1124 unsigned ScratchAlignShift = 10;
1125 // We need to program the hardware with the amount of scratch memory that
1126 // is used by the entire wave. ProgInfo.ScratchSize is the amount of
1127 // scratch memory used per thread.
1128 ProgInfo.ScratchBlocks =
1129 alignTo(ProgInfo.ScratchSize * STM.getWavefrontSize(),
1130 1ULL << ScratchAlignShift) >>
1131 ScratchAlignShift;
1132
1133 if (getIsaVersion(getGlobalSTI()->getCPU()).Major >= 10) {
1134 ProgInfo.WgpMode = STM.isCuModeEnabled() ? 0 : 1;
1135 ProgInfo.MemOrdered = 1;
1136 }
1137
1138 // 0 = X, 1 = XY, 2 = XYZ
1139 unsigned TIDIGCompCnt = 0;
1140 if (MFI->hasWorkItemIDZ())
1141 TIDIGCompCnt = 2;
1142 else if (MFI->hasWorkItemIDY())
1143 TIDIGCompCnt = 1;
1144
1145 ProgInfo.ComputePGMRSrc2 =
1146 S_00B84C_SCRATCH_EN(ProgInfo.ScratchBlocks > 0) |
1147 S_00B84C_USER_SGPR(MFI->getNumUserSGPRs()) |
1148 // For AMDHSA, TRAP_HANDLER must be zero, as it is populated by the CP.
1149 S_00B84C_TRAP_HANDLER(STM.isAmdHsaOS() ? 0 : STM.isTrapHandlerEnabled()) |
1150 S_00B84C_TGID_X_EN(MFI->hasWorkGroupIDX()) |
1151 S_00B84C_TGID_Y_EN(MFI->hasWorkGroupIDY()) |
1152 S_00B84C_TGID_Z_EN(MFI->hasWorkGroupIDZ()) |
1153 S_00B84C_TG_SIZE_EN(MFI->hasWorkGroupInfo()) |
1154 S_00B84C_TIDIG_COMP_CNT(TIDIGCompCnt) |
1155 S_00B84C_EXCP_EN_MSB(0) |
1156 // For AMDHSA, LDS_SIZE must be zero, as it is populated by the CP.
1157 S_00B84C_LDS_SIZE(STM.isAmdHsaOS() ? 0 : ProgInfo.LDSBlocks) |
1158 S_00B84C_EXCP_EN(0);
1159
1160 ProgInfo.Occupancy = STM.computeOccupancy(MF.getFunction(), ProgInfo.LDSSize,
1161 ProgInfo.NumSGPRsForWavesPerEU,
1162 ProgInfo.NumVGPRsForWavesPerEU);
1163 }
